Located in Michigan's Upper Peninsula, the Sturgeon River is another federally protected wild and scenic river. The Wild and Scenic Sturgeon River rushes out of the northern portion of this wilderness, over the 20 foot volcanic outcroppings of Sturgeon Falls, and through a gorge that reaches 350 feet in depth and a mile in width. Sturgeon River is a 106-mile-long (171 km)[2]♙river in Baraga County and Houghton County in the U.S. state of Michigan. At almost one million acres, the Ottawa National Forest encompasses some of the most wild woodlands in the Upper Peninsula, much of it aspen and maple that turn brilliant colors in the fall.
